Transaction 3a61d224e69a75bc8caaf4316718bef5f54fc010eb04bd2e4e0737e973bf9069

block
177e0ec69d63dc6a1484f3307e9412b3a983132f99a60dc7b0202e83b26b1106

1 Input

3 Outputs